Ticket: FIELD-2281 — Expired credentials blocking offline sync

For the weekly sync: the Heronpath field-survey app's offline mode stopped reconciling on Monday because the cached sync token expired while crews were out of coverage. Surveys queued locally are intact, but uploads fail silently until re-auth. We've extended token lifetime to 30 days and reissued credentials. The replacement key for the internal sync service follows.

service key, fafog-fahaf: vxb3-x55

## Escalation — Reminder Dispatch Job (Larkfield Clinics)

If the appointment reminder job on Larkfield's scheduler fails twice consecutively, do not retry manually; duplicate reminders have caused patient confusion before. Verify the dedupe table first, then page the scheduling on-call. Any change touching reminder templates requires a second reviewer sign-off. If the dedupe table itself is corrupted, escalate immediately to the data integrity lead.

billing contact of yawip-yadup = druath.casdor@nelvrolabs.internal

Effective 3 March: Level 9 at the Dunmore Quay building is open. Visitors sign in at ground reception only — no direct lift access. Hosts collect guests in person and escort them throughout. Contractors need a facilities-issued day pass before going up. Deliveries route through the loading bay, not the Level 9 lobby. Facilities desk staff attending the floor for setup work should enter via the north stair using the pass code below.

badge for fafop-fajof: bdg-Z-47

Onboarding note for future maintainers of the Quillmere digest pipeline. The batch email digest scheduler assembles per-user summaries every six hours and hands them to the Larkspool delivery tier. If the scheduler's credential cache is wiped — which happens on every host rebuild — it cannot enqueue batches until its service identity is recovered. Recovery is deliberately manual: open the Larkspool operator shell, select the scheduler identity, and choose "restore from passphrase." When prompted, enter exactly the passphrase shown below.

unlock words, yawig-kagef: gordor-holvan-ulaael-pramir-ulaiel-tamdor